Welcome to on-call for the Glimmerpane design system! Our snapshot tests live in the `snapcheck` suite and run on every merge to main. If a UI component changes visually, the diff bot flags it — usually it's an intentional tweak, so just approve the new baseline. If it's 2am and snapshots are failing across the board, it's almost always a font-loading race, not your problem. To unlock the baseline store and re-approve snapshots in bulk, use the recovery passphrase below.

recovery phrase for tahag-taguf: wenix-caswyn

Welcome to the Marrowfield catalogue importer. It pulls MARC-ish records from the Dunleary union feed nightly and dedupes against our local shelf index. Reviewers: the dedupe step is where most bugs hide, so read the matcher tests first. To run the importer locally you'll need feed access, since the Dunleary endpoint rejects anonymous pulls. The importer loads its env file from the repo root, so drop the feed credential in there.

secret setting of hawep-yahig: LEDGER_TOKEN29=41b5d6315371c92885eaeb077fb63

Action item: The Relayn deploy-status bot silently dropped updates when the pipeline API paginated results, so responders believed a rollback had completed when it had not. We will add pagination handling, a staleness banner, and an integration test. Until merged, verify deploy state directly in the pipeline console, documented at the page below.

runbook for kahop-kajop: https://rundeck.ordinio.test/display/secrets/pipeline/issue/pages/repo/browse/e5732776e07d1285107e5aeb